Transaction 66f3360bc63a0557af52acbe8c25092b22e32ce73e791083e8fd087061850df9

1 Input
2 Outputs
  • 66f3360bc63a0557af52acbe8c25092b22e32ce73e791083e8fd087061850df9:0
  • value  70000000
    address  39RWLeqFM3YaPd4CwAWB2fSMXVEuDNGU2x
  • 66f3360bc63a0557af52acbe8c25092b22e32ce73e791083e8fd087061850df9:1
  • value  222375362
    address  bc1qnsupj8eqya02nm8v6tmk93zslu2e2z8chlmcej